gdb: 2008-08-01 Emi Suzuki Organize the check for the need of thread hopping. * infrun.c (handle_inferior_event): Remove the call of breakpoint_thread_match. Call single_step_breakpoint_inserted_here_p instead of checking singlestep_breakpoint_inserted_p. Update a comment. * breakpoint.c (single_step_breakpoint_inserted_here_p): Make global. Delete prototype. * breakpoint.h (single_step_breakpoint_inserted_here_p): Declare. gdb/testsuite: 2008-07-09 Emi Suzuki * gdb.threads/thread-specific2.exp, gdb.threads/thread-specific2.c: New tests.
